Venice's Battle Against Overtourism: Strategies for Sustainable Tourism
In recent years, Venice has been grappling with the negative impacts of overtourism, as the city has become overwhelmed by the sheer number of visitors flocking to its historic streets and canals. To combat this issue, the city has implemented various strategies to promote sustainable tourism and ensure that Venice remains a livable city for residents.
One of the key initiatives that Venice has introduced is the implementation of a visitor management system, which aims to regulate the flow of tourists into the city and distribute them more evenly throughout the year. This system includes measures such as limiting the number of cruise ships that can dock in the city and promoting off-peak travel periods to reduce overcrowding in popular tourist areas.
Furthermore, Venice has been working on diversifying its tourism offerings beyond the usual attractions, such as promoting cultural events, local craftsmanship, and sustainable practices. By highlighting these unique aspects of the city, Venice hopes to attract a more discerning and respectful type of tourist who appreciates the city's heritage and contributes positively to its economy.
